Clinical Disease Characteristics and Treatment Trajectories Associated with Mortality among COVID-19 Patients in Punjab, Pakistan.

Muhammad Zeeshan MunirAmer Hayat KhanTahir Mehmood Khan
Published in: Healthcare (Basel, Switzerland) (2023)
Older males having breathing difficulties or signs of organ failure with raised C-reactive protein or D-dimer levels had high mortality. Antivirals, corticosteroids, tocilizumab, and ivermectin had better outcomes; antivirals were associated with lower mortality risk.
